Celebrating the Teacher in Us: Journeying as Teaching, Teaching as Journeying

Teachers, educators, and administrators of Teacher Education Institutions from different parts of the Philippines gathered last 30 September 2015 at the Pearl Hall of SEAMEO INNOTECH to celebrate the National Teachers’ Month. The celebration was held through a forum entitled “Celebrating the Teacher in Us: Journeying as Teaching, Teaching as Journeying”.

Dr. Ramon C. Bacani, SEAMEO INNOTECH Center Director, opened the celebration. In his remarks, he emphasized the importance of teaching. He also mentioned about the Strategic Dialogue of Education Ministers (SDEM) that the Center has facilitated. The dialogue yielded seven priority areas of SEAMEO for 2015-2035, one of which is on teacher education and making teaching a profession of choice.

Mr. Aniceto “Chito” Sobrepeña, President of the Metrobank Foundation, was also present in the event. He talked about the Annual Search for Outstanding Teachers and some of the Foundation’s awardees for the past years. He also mentioned that the National Teachers’ Month is the longest celebration in the Philippines as this celebration does not end by just thanking the teachers but continues as long as we recognize teaching as a noble job.

The forum was facilitated by Dr. Allan de Guzman, President of NOTED (Network of Outstanding Teachers and Educators), Inc. and Dean of the College of Education, University of Santo Tomas. It was a fun and interactive event where participants were able to rekindle their passion for teaching.

The panelists—Dr. Hilda C. Montaño, 2012 Outstanding Teacher for Higher Education; Ms. Amcy M. Esteban, 2015 Outstanding Teacher for Elementary Education; and Ms. Milagros C. Banan, 2015 Outstanding Teacher for Secondary Education—shared their teaching experiences by answering prepared questions from the worksheet. They were asked about their beginnings as teachers, their struggles, the classroom innovations they have introduced, and their fulfilment as stewards of learning. They also shared some tips for the pre-service teachers present in the forum.

The event concluded with two video tributes for teachers. Ms. Josephine C. Calamlam, 1999 Outstanding Teacher for Elementary Education, gave the closing remarks. She emphasized how important teaching and teachers are for the future of the nation. She finished her remarks by asking everyone to rise and say to the teachers next to them: “Stand up teachers and the world will stand for you!”

“Celebrating the Teacher in Us: Journeying as Teaching, Teaching as Journeying”, is a forum jointly organized by SEAMEO INNOTECH and NOTED, Inc. in celebration of the National Teachers’ Month and World Teacher’s Day.
